BMC  BMC Developmental Biology - Image highlight


We are delighted to announce the winner of BMC Developmental Biology's Image of the Year. Congratulations to W Scott Argraves and colleagues from the Medical University of South Carolina, whose image showing a wild-type mouse embryo 9.5 days post coitum was selected by the BMC Developmental Biology editorial team. BMC Developmental Biology's Image of the Year was chosen from the archive of BMC Developmental Biology Image of the Month, launched in 2005.

Image of the Year

Wild-type mouse embryo 9.5 days post coitum. To assess the effect of targeted cubilin knockdown on blood vessel formation, embryos were immunolabeled with anti-PECAM-1, an endothelial cell marker. Cubilin-deficient embryos display developmental retardation and do not advance morphologically beyond the appearance of WT 8-8.5 dpc embryos.

Taken from: Smith et al. BMC Developmental Biology 2006, 6:30 [View article]
